Yesterday the Israeli broadcaster KAN revealed the slogan to accompany Eurovision 2019 in Tel Aviv – DARE TO DREAM! Slogans have been part of Eurovision since 2002 and each host city devises one to sum up their hopes, themes and generally message of their contest. But what we […]
